About
Japanese Lessen makes it easy for children to write letters, even if they are not yet confident in their handwriting.
It can also be used to practice writing Japanese characters and has been adopted by educational institutions.
How to Write a Letter
1. Create a template for the letter.
The app automatically converts the template into tracing images.
2. Children trace the template images to write the letter in their own handwriting.
3. Decorate the finished letter using the built-in painting tools.
Features
* Supports Gothic, Mincho, and Klee One (a font similar to Japanese textbook handwriting) for templates.
* Share completed letters as images.
* Supports stroke order for Hiragana, Katakana, and numbers.
